lather

/ˈlæðər/

बरु

noun

1. soapsuds, suds
the froth produced by soaps or detergents
2. fret, stew, sweat, swither
agitation resulting from active worry
"don't get in a stew"
"he's in a sweat about exams"
3. lather
a workman who puts up laths
4. lather
the foam resulting from excessive sweating (as on a horse)

verb

1. flog, welt, whip, lash, slash, strap, trounce
beat severely with a whip or rod
"The teacher often flogged the students"
"The children were severely trounced"
2. lather
form a lather
"The shaving cream lathered"
3. lather
exude sweat or lather
"this unfit horse lathers easily"
4. soap
rub soap all over, usually with the purpose of cleaning
